WebAug 13, 2014 · LOCO – The god of wild vegetation with all its gifts, from fruits to herbs for healing and poisons for killing. By extension he is also the patron deity of doctors and of Houngans (Voodoo priests). His wife is the goddess Ayizan. In Greek mythology, Hypnos was a deity who took the form of an owl and flapped its wings to make men sleep. It was known to the Romans under the name of Somnus. Son of Nyx, the night was also, according to the Iliad, the twin brother of Tànato or Thanatos, the god who personified death.
